WebHow do I get a C wire? If you're lucky when you upgrade to a newer thermostat that requires this connection, there will be an extra (unused) wire in the cable at the thermostat. If you're not, you'll have to run new … WebAdd a C-Wire Transformer. This simple solution allows you to get around the C-wire problem without the need to even add said wire. Instead, a C-wire transformer plugs directly into a household electrical outlet and is connected to your thermostat. WebA C-wire, or a common wire, runs from your low voltage heating system (24v) and carries continuous power to your thermostat.
